Kumrai Khura is an inhabited village in Donka Sub-district of Karbi Anglong district, Assam. Its Census village code is 295304, the Census 2011 record lists 238 people in 43 households and the reported area is 627 hectares. The local references include Amri CD Block and the nearest town reference is Jagiroad at about 67 km.

Jagiroad is the nearest town listed for Kumrai Khura, about 67 km away. Diphu is listed as the district headquarters at about 238 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 238 people in 43 households, with 114 male residents and 124 female residents. The average household size is 5.53,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 0% for Kumrai Khura. Population density works out to about 37.96 people per sq km.
Education entries for Kumrai Khura list 1 government primary school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Kumrai Khura include river or canal water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Kumrai Khura include all-weather road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Kumrai Khura include Anganwadi centre.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Kumrai Khura is reported as 99 hours per day in summer and 99 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Kumrai Khura show that reported agricultural commodities include Rice and Jhum Cultivation and net sown area is 50 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
